Output 8418938e5c0ba43cd0de562563023c7bfbb4992185dd7bea130a87d05b47b12c:1

value
26791432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b6a0ea1cc414a3809429bb854287315b1b824a OP_EQUAL
address
3MMbz3SkJtr8aYmjpTx3GVNca5wWSpT4xM
transaction
8418938e5c0ba43cd0de562563023c7bfbb4992185dd7bea130a87d05b47b12c
spent
true